A Review of Numerous Parallel Multigrid Methods
Multigrid methods originated earlier this century, in the personnel computing era. Someone who needed to compute an approximation to the solution of a partial di erential equation during that era would ll a room with people. After using very simple mechanical calculators to compute parts of the approximation, these people would pass their parts to the other people in the room who needed them. Except for the very di erent time scales and approximate solution accuracy, this process is similar to computing on today's distributed memory parallel computers. The most basic model problem for elliptic boundary value problems in multigrid has always been, e ectively, the two dimensional Poisson equation
